Cross-site request forgery ( CSRF, sometimes pronounced “sea surf” and not to be confused with cross-site scripting) is a simple yet invasive malicious exploit of a website. It involves a cyberattacker adding a button or link to a suspicious website that makes a request to another site you’re authenticated on. WebApr 29, 2015 · This solution will apply CSRF protection to all content pages that inherit from the Site.Master page. The following requirements must be met for this solution to work: All web forms making data modifications must use the Site.Master page. All requests making data modifications must use the ViewState.
